Investigation Summary

Investigation Nr: 167213.015
Event: 06/05/2024
Employee suffers fatal heat stroke due to excessive ambient

At 3:15 p.m. on June 5, 2024, employees noticed that their coworker, Employee #1, appeared unwell and advised him to go to the car and cool off in the air conditioning. About 15 minutes later, the employee was found on the ground experiencing convulsions. Emergency services were called, and paramedics performed CPR while transporting the employee to the hospital. Unfortunately, Employee #1 was pronounced dead on arrival. At 5:18 p.m., the Medical Examiner recorded the employee's core temperature at 108.7°F. The cause of death was determined to be heat stroke due to excessive ambient heat.

Keywords: CPR, Ground, Heat Stroke, Heat index, Unconsciousness
